Laverton vs Doha Climate & Distance Between

Qatar flag
  • The distance between Laverton, Australia and Doha, Qatar is approximately 11,959 km or 7,431 mi.
  • To reach Laverton in this distance one would set out from Doha bearing 124.2°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Laverton bearing 108.7° or ESE .
  • Laverton has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Doha has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• The mean temperature is 12.1 °C (21.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.9 °C (12.4°F) less in Laverton.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 493.7 mm (19.4 in) more which is equivalent to 493.7 l/m² (12.12 US gal/ft²) or 4,937,000 l/ha (527,798 US gal/ac) more. About 7 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.2° lower in Laverton than in Doha.
